Yes, you can legalize a dirt bike in Kansas. You will, however, have to take the bike to the nearest motor vehicles bureau in your respective city. Once there, a bureau official will inspect the bike to make sure it meets all state riding requirements. If the bike does pass the examination, you will be free to ride it.

Laws regarding riding a bike on the sidewalk vary by location. In some places, it is illegal to ride a bike on the sidewalk, while in others it is allowed. It is important to check the local laws and regulations in your area to determine if it is legal to ride a bike on the sidewalk.
